Introduction to the Ohio License Agreement: The Ohio License Agreement refers to a legally binding contract established between Site-Based Media, Inc. (hereinafter referred to as "Licensee") and NBC Site Media, Inc. (hereinafter referred to as "Licensor"). The agreement outlines the terms and conditions under which Licensee is granted the right to use certain intellectual properties, assets, or services owned by Licensor in the state of Ohio. 2. Detailed Description of the Ohio License Agreement: The Ohio License Agreement encompasses a wide range of provisions, covering the scope and limitations of the licensee's rights, obligations, and responsibilities. It typically includes the following key elements: a. Purpose and Scope: This section outlines the main objective of the agreement, specifying the type of intellectual properties or services being licensed, the scope of their usage, and any geographical or temporal limitations. b. License Grant: The agreement defines the specific rights and permissions granted to the licensee, ensuring clarity regarding the licensed materials, their intended use, and any restrictions imposed by the licensor. c. Term and Termination: This section specifies the duration of the license agreement, including any renewal options, termination clauses, and conditions under which either party may terminate the agreement. d. Payment Terms: The agreement outlines the financial obligations of the licensee, including any upfront fees, royalties, or revenue-sharing provisions, and the payment schedule. e. Intellectual Property Rights: This section clarifies the ownership and protection of intellectual properties involved in the agreement, ensuring that the licensee understands the licensor's rights and any restrictions on usage, duplication, or modification. f. Confidentiality and Non-Disclosure: The agreement may include provisions to safeguard confidential information, trade secrets, or proprietary data shared between both parties during the licensing period. g. Indemnification and Limitation of Liability: To mitigate potential legal risks, the license agreement may address indemnification clauses, limitations on liability, and dispute resolution mechanisms, including arbitration or mediation procedures. 3. Attachments: Depending on the specific terms and requirements of the licensee and licensor, various attachments may be included in the Ohio License Agreement to provide further details or specifications. Some examples of attachments that may be present include: a. Schedule of Licensed Intellectual Properties: This attachment lists and describes the intellectual properties or services covered by the agreement, including trademarks, patents, copyrights, or trade secrets. b. Technical Specifications: When the license agreement involves the use of particular technologies or technical requirements, this attachment provides comprehensive details on the specifications, standards, or methods to be followed. c. Exhibit of Fees and Royalties: In cases where payment terms are complex or need additional explanation, an exhibit can be attached, specifying the exact amount, calculation methods, and deadlines for the fees and royalties.
